§945. Department of Marine Resources 1. Major policy-influencing positions. The following positions are major policy-influencing positions within the Department of Marine Resources. Notwithstanding any other provision of law, these positions and their successor positions are subject to this chapter: A. Deputy Commissioner; [PL 2005, c. 519, Pt. S, §1 (AMD).]B. Chief, Bureau of Marine Patrol; [PL 1995, c. 395, Pt. E, §1 (AMD).]C. [PL 1985, c. 481, Pt. A, §10 (RP).]D. Assistant to the Commissioner for Public Information; [PL 1995, c. 395, Pt. E, §2 (AMD).]E. [PL 2007, c. 1, Pt. E, §1 (RP).] F. [PL 2013, c. 368, Pt. CCC, §1 (RP).] G. Director, External Affairs; and [PL 2013, c. 368, Pt. CCC, §2 (AMD).]H. Assistant to the Commissioner for Communications.
